Comment: ARD-69 is a potent proteolysis-targeting chimera (PROTAC) degrader of the androgen receptor (AR) that was designed as a proof-of-concept lead to evaluate the potential of PROTAC technology as a novel treatment mechanism for AR-positive, castration-resistant prostate cancer [2]. It contains an AR antagonist (reported in [1]) that binds the AR, joined by a small linker molecule to a second ligand (in this case a VHL ligand) that engages the E3 ubiquitin ligase system via Cullin-2. This chimeric molecular structure targets AR protein for ubiquitination-dependent proteolysis.
